Last summer, as one of 15 Adobe AR Artists in Residence, Tse offered a vision of what those new worlds might do. At the Festival of the Impossible, sponsored by Adobe, Tse and her colleagues blended gallery artwork with AR integrations (see the video of Tse's exhibit above). Behind the scenes, Adobe was learning about the user experience of Project Aero, its AR authoring tool.
If Tse is easy with new forms, her background might explain why. Her B.A. from UCLA is in sociology, but she is also trained and experienced in illustration, visual design, web design and front-end development. None of that background is left out of her work.
"Right now, in this exploration phase, my limitations are the technology and what is available," she says. But that's why collaboration between technologists like Adobe developers and artists is so vital. "Right now, the two are so deeply entwined, they have to have space to play with each other, art and science, in order to produce something new."
